Frequently Asked Questions. What is the Arizona Charitable Tax Credit? Arizona allows you to take a dollar-for-dollar credit on your state taxes when you donate up to $470 for single filers, or $938 for married couples filing jointly to a qualified organization.

The form for filing a composite return will be the Arizona Nonresident Personal Income Tax Return, Form 140NR. 2. The Residency Status box, Composite Return, on page 1 must be checked. Note: To amend the composite return use the Arizona Individual Amended Income Tax Return, Form 140X.

Filing an Individual Extension To file an extension on an individual return, individuals use Arizona Form 204 to apply for an automatic extension to file.

Taxpayers Making Contributions or Paying Fees The public school tax credit is claimed by the individual taxpayer on Form 322. The maximum credit allowed is $400 for married filing joint filers and $200 for single, heads of household and married filing separate filers.

The Charitable Tax Credit allows Arizona donors like you to get back your HandsOn Greater Phoenix charitable donation as a state tax refund or credit against what you owe in state taxes up to $470 ($938 if married filing jointly). It's easy, and there's no need to itemize.

To submit the Arizona Form 285-I, ensure the form is fully completed with accurate information. You can mail the form to the Arizona Department of Revenue at 1600 West Monroe, Phoenix, AZ 85007 or fax it to (602) 542-3042.
